France is estimated to possess 290 nuclear weapons, of which about 280 are deployed. The remaining weapons are thought to be in maintenance or storage. The vast majority, or approximately 240, are deployed by the French Navy, which maintains a continuous at-sea presence via its nuclear-powered submarines.Can France make nuclear weapons?
France tested its first nuclear weapon in 1960 and is one of five nuclear weapon states recognized under the NPT. It currently possesses the world's fourth largest nuclear stockpile, deliverable by submarine and air-launched cruise missiles.Does Canada have a nuclear weapon?

Australia does not possess any nuclear weapons and is not seeking to become a nuclear weapon state. Australia's core obligations as a non-nuclear-weapon state are set out in the NPT. They include a solemn undertaking not to acquire nuclear weapons.Does the UK have nukes?
The UK is recognized as one of the five nuclear weapon states under the Nuclear Nonproliferation Treaty. It currently possesses four ballistic missile submarines and has maintained a continuous deployment of nuclear weapons at sea since 1969. The UK abandoned its chemical and biological weapons programs in the 1950's.Why is France so good at nuclear?

Nine countries possess nuclear weapons: the United States, Russia, France, China, the United Kingdom, Pakistan, India, Israel, and North Korea. In total, the global nuclear stockpile is close to 13,000 weapons.Does Switzerland have nuclear weapons?
Switzerland is a party to the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ty (NPT) as a non-nuclear weapons state. Its safeguards agreement under the NPT came into force in 1978.Where would a nuclear bomb hit in the US from Russia?

Countries' Nuclear Arsenals from Largest to Smallest
- Russia (5,977 warheads)
- United States (5,428)
- China (350)
- France (290)
- United Kingdom (225)
- Pakistan (165)
- India (160)
- Israel (90)
